TPS61103RGER Tech Specifications

Product Attribute Attribute Value
Category PMIC - Voltage Regulators - Linear Switching
Manufacturer Texas Instruments
Surface Mount YES
Package / Case 24-VFQFN Exposed Pad
Mounting Type Surface Mount
Number of Pins 24Pins
Weight 43.204673mg
Packaging Cut Tape (CT)
Operating Temperature -40°C~85°C
JESD-609 Code e4
Part Status Obsolete
Moisture Sensitivity Level (MSL) 2 (1 Year)
Number of Terminations 24Terminations
ECCN Code EAR99
Terminal Finish Nickel/Palladium/Gold (Ni/Pd/Au)
Voltage - Supply 0.8V~3.3V
Terminal Position QUAD
Peak Reflow Temperature (Cel) 260
Number of Functions 1Function
Terminal Pitch 0.5mm
Base Part Number TPS61103
Pin Count 24
Number of Outputs 2Outputs
Efficiency 95 %
Output Voltage 3.6V
Product Attribute Attribute Value
Output Type Adjustable, Fixed
Operating Supply Voltage 3.3V
Input Voltage-Nom 1.8V
Analog IC - Other Type SWITCHING REGULATOR
Output Current 270mA
Quiescent Current 65μA
Voltage - Output 2 3.6V
Topology Step-Up (Boost) Synchronous (1), Linear (LDO) (1)
Min Input Voltage 800mV
Control Mode CURRENT-MODE
Frequency - Switching 500kHz
Max Input Voltage 3.3V
Control Technique PULSE WIDTH MODULATION
Current - Output 1 1.8A
Max Output Power 600mW
Current - Output 2 500mA
w/Sequencer No
Voltage/Current - Output 1 3.3V 1.8A
Voltage/Current - Output 2 0.9V~3.6V 500mA
Width 4mm
Height Seated (Max) 1mm
Length 4mm
RoHS Status ROHS3 Compliant
Lead Free Lead Free
